According to FMCSA records, C&w Trucking (DOT# 1457229) in Bettendorf, Iowa has 391 inspections on record with 345 violations and a 15.3% vehicle out-of-service rate and 19 crashes, including 1 fatal. Safety grade: B. Active common authority.

Out-of-Service Rates vs. National Average
An out-of-service (OOS) violation means a vehicle or driver was found unsafe to operate during a roadside inspection and was prohibited from continuing until the issue was corrected.
Vehicle OOS Rate15.3%
Carrier: 15.3% (60 of 391)National: 23.2%
Driver OOS Rate1.8%
Carrier: 1.8% (7 of 391)National: 6.4%

Violation Categories · 345 total violations
FMCSA groups violations into Behavioral Analysis and Safety Improvement Categories (BASICs). Each violation found during a roadside inspection is classified into a category that reflects the type of safety risk.
345total violations across 391 inspections
71violations resulted in out-of-service orders (21%)

Inspection History · 100 records
FMCSA inspections range from Level 1 (full vehicle and driver examination) to Level 6 (enhanced motorcoach inspection). Level 1 is the most thorough; Levels 2 and 3 are walk-around and driver-only checks.

Authority & Insurance
FMCSA operating authority permits interstate for-hire transportation. Carriers must maintain minimum insurance coverage levels to keep authority active. BIPD (bodily injury and property damage) insurance is required for all for-hire carriers.
